Abstract
The utility model discloses a kind of boxes for keys, including rack, key gives back device, cabinet for storing keys and the key dispensing apparatus the key of cabinet to be exported to cabinet, cabinet is equipped with the containing cavities for storing keys, it includes insertion seat that key, which gives back device, first driving mechanism, position stop piece and the first key identifier, insertion seat is set to the top of cabinet and is inserted into seat and is equipped with for plugging for key and key being imported the insertion guide groove in containing cavities, position stop piece is slidably laterally inserted between insertion seat and cabinet or slidable be laterally inserted in is inserted on seat for separating or being connected insertion guide groove and containing cavities, first driving mechanism is installed on insertion seat for driving position stop piece to slide back and forth horizontally, first key identifier is installed on insertion seat and is led with being inserted into insertion for identification Key into slot, cabinet and key dispensing apparatus are all installed in rack.The key cabinet is simple, easy to use, at low cost.

The use principle of boxes for keys embodiment one are as follows: when key 50 is put into the insertion guide groove being inserted on seat 31 by user
In 311, the first key identifier 34 carries out identification 50 information of key, and after recognizing 50 information of key, position stop piece 33 is first
It is moved under the action of driving mechanism 32, after being inserted into guide groove 311 and containing cavities 21 are connected, key 50 is fallen under gravity into
In containing cavities 21, the first driving mechanism 32 resets, and key 50 gives back success, if the first key identifier 34 does not recognize key
Spoon 50, the first driving mechanism 32 will not work, and user, which need to shift one's position key 50, is reentered into insertion guide groove 311,
Repeat above-mentioned movement, as do not recognize yet number be more than three times if the key 50 radio frequency will failure, when one of containing cavities
21 when having stored enough keys 50, and insertion seat 31 moves under the action of the second driving mechanism 35, and insertion guide groove 311 will
The surface of another containing cavities 21 is moved to, boxes for keys can continue to store key 50;When user of service is in key dispensing apparatus 40
It is external choose receive key 50 after, key ejecting mechanism 41 drives the push rod 4121 on the second sliding part 412 to push mandril past
The spring in cabinet 20 is moved and compressed afterwards, and 50 lower position of key is hanging after mandril is mobile, effect of the key 50 in gravity
Under can move down a position filling space, then the push rod 4121 on the second sliding part 412 back moves, and mandril is in spring
Under the action of back move and key 50 be pushed into guiding conveying frame 47, key 50 falls under gravity into convertible plummer
On 43, the second key identifier carries out the information of identification key 50, and system can bind user and key 50 after identifying successfully
Information, the 4th sliding part 442 after binding success in the 4th driving mechanism 44 move right, and plummer 43 is driven to overturn to the right,
Key 50 is poured into key export orientation frame 46, key 50, which is provided, to be completed;If key 50 fall into after plummer 43 three seconds not at
Function reads the label information in key 50, then the 4th sliding part 442 in the 4th driving mechanism 44 is moved to the left, and drives plummer
43 overturn to the left, and key 50 is poured into key recycling box 45, and there may be problems to need replacing for the label for illustrating on key 50, are
System prompt is got again, repeats above step, after the key 50 on a containing cavities 21 has been led, third driving mechanism
42 driving key ejecting mechanisms 41 are moved at the position of another containing cavities 21.
